AM radio stations stand to gain relief from a potential permanent shift to daylight saving time after Sen. Tom Cotton (R-AR) restated his plan to filibuster the Sunshine Protection Act.
The legislation, which the House has already passed, would lock the United States into year-round daylight saving time. Cotton has pledged to block it when Congress returns from recess, preventing the measure from advancing in the Senate.
Permanent daylight saving time would delay winter sunrises, often pushing them past 8 or 9 a.m. in many parts of the country. That change would disrupt morning drive-time listening for daytime-only AM stations and those required to operate at reduced power or with directional antenna patterns after local sunset—problems broadcasters have flagged for years as a threat to their operations and audiences.
Operational Restrictions in Practice
- Day/night mode changes: Many stations switch at local sunset from a higher-power, often non-directional (or less directional) daytime mode to a lower-power and/or highly directional nighttime mode (DA-N or DA-2 patterns). Some use completely different antenna systems or sites.
- Daytimers: These Class D stations must sign off at sunset or operate at very low nighttime power (often a few watts to under 250 W). Their signals would otherwise interfere with distant clear-channel or regional stations via skywave.
- Directional antennas: Required for many Class A and B stations at night (and sometimes by day) to null radiation toward protected stations while concentrating energy toward desired service areas.
- Critical hours and transitional authority: The periods immediately around sunrise and sunset involve transitional ionospheric conditions. Eligible stations (especially daytimers) can apply for Pre-Sunrise Authorization (PSRA) and Post-Sunset Authorization (PSSA). These allow limited power (capped at 500 W or the station’s daytime power, whichever is lower) in the two hours before local sunrise and after local sunset. Permissible levels are calculated in 15-minute increments based on interference protection and are recalculated periodically (most recently updated by the FCC in 2024 after a long gap.
Impacts and Relevance to Daylight Saving Time
These restrictions directly affect coverage, especially during morning and evening drive times—the most valuable advertising periods. Daytimers and reduced-power stations lose audience when they must cut power or sign off while people are still commuting. Because switch times are tied to local solar sunrise and sunset (not clock time), permanent daylight saving time would push winter clock-time sunrises later (often after 8–9 a.m. in many areas). Stations would remain on nighttime (low-power or off) parameters deeper into the morning commute, shrinking coverage precisely when listenership peaks. This is the core concern raised by AM broadcasters regarding the Sunshine Protection Act.
